`
JerryWang_SAP
  • 浏览: 1036518 次
  • 性别: Icon_minigender_1
  • 来自: 成都
文章分类
社区版块
存档分类
最新评论

一个基于SAP Hybris Commerce和微信的社交电商原型介绍

阅读更多

本文是2020年第12篇原创文章,也是汪子熙公众号总共第195篇原创文章。

汪子熙在刚刚过去的SAP中国上海2020 DKOM大会上,SAP大佬们在Key Note讲话时提到了最近国内火爆的线上新经济和一些现象级的商业模式,比如红遍各大社交媒体的李佳琪:


以及拥有口号“用鲜花点亮生活”的鲜花订阅服务提供商,Follower Plus(花加).

当Jerry在SAP上海DKOM现场看到大屏幕上出现花加的照片时,和身旁的同事发出了会心的微笑,因为很凑巧,这次我们SAP成都研究院数字创新空间到上海DKOM的一个展台,展示的一个原型开发,就是和社交电商相关,和鲜花相关。


可以先通过下面这个简短的视频了解一下我们设计的这个基于SAP Hybris Commerce和微信的社交电商场景。

假设一位喜欢鲜花的文艺女青年Jane(SAP成都研究院数字创新空间的UX设计师,关于她的详细介绍,参考Jerry的文章:SAP成都研究院数字创新空间沟通S/4HANA和C/4HANA的智能服务演示视频和Coresystems分享预告),某天踱步进了一家鲜花小店,看到一盆盆争芳斗艳盛开着的鲜花,一下子勾起了Jane购买的欲望。


Jane掏出手机对准其中一盆鲜花盆底贴着的二维码扫一扫:

我们假设这家实体花店是某品牌花店的连锁店之一,线上使用了SAP Hybris Commerce解决方案。Jane扫描二维码关注公众号之后,公众号对应的后台服务根据Jane的微信open ID去Hybris Backoffice查询,发现没有对应的用户,就自动创建一个新的用户,绑定到Jane的微信open ID上去。这个操作可以通过SAP Commerce Cloud提供的Restful API完成。

花店里的每盆花,也早已作为产品主数据维护在SAP Hybris Commerce Backoffice里了:

Jane在微信里可以浏览这些维护在Hybris Commerce Backoffice产品主数据里的描述信息,比如该种花的保养方式,花期,香味特色等。决定购买之后,Jane直接在微信里通过公众号的菜单去下单。公众号的下单实现,调用Commerce Order Restful API去创建订单。

细节在Jerry之前的文章 如何使用API的方式消费SAP Commerce Cloud的订单服务 里有介绍。

我们的后台服务收到Hybris Commerce Order API调用的响应之后,给Jane的微信推送一条收集其购买体验的消息。


这个调查问卷的背后,我们使用了去年1月份SAP收购的Qualtrics服务:

Jane点开了微信收到的“反馈体验”消息后,发现是一个网页:

点击Share Feedbacks之后,Jane的微信会跳转一个基于Qualtrics的调查问卷页面去。

Jane在调查问卷里填写的反馈可以在Qualtrics dashboard里看到:

其中第三个问题,“你愿意成为一个虚拟花店的店主吗?” 一旦Jane选择了Yes,点击Submit Feedbacks后,Jane可以从Hybris Commerce Backoffice配置好的几种花里面,选择部分放到她的虚拟花店里进行销售。


点击上图的“Build My Flower Store", 会生成一张图片,包含了Jane专属的虚拟花店二维码。


接下来Jane就可以把这张图片往她的微信朋友圈和各大微信群,以及其他社交媒体上推送了:

其他朋友扫描Jane的虚拟花店的微信二维码,能浏览Jane虚拟花店里的鲜花,下单购买:

 

因为Jane的朋友的下单动作也是在微信里完成的,因此在这个订单创建完成之后,我们可以用编程的方式,实现给Jane赠送优惠券或其他礼品的逻辑。这个赠送动作,我们可以用同步或者异步的方式实现。

假设Jane的朋友Robin扫码打开了Jane的虚拟花店进行下单,我们会将Jane的微信open ID传递到Robin的扫码下单网页里。那么在Robin扫码下单的上下文里,就能知道当前这个订单是基于Jane的微信open ID创建的。如果采用同步的方式赠送优惠券,在Robin的订单创建成功返回之后,根据Jane的微信open ID找到其在Hybris Commerce里对应的用户,然后使用Commerce Cloud里的Customer Coupons API,将预先配置好的优惠券分配给Jane.

 

详细操作步骤参考Jerry之前的文章: 浅谈SAP CRM和Hybris Commerce里的价格折扣实现

如果采用异步方式实现,可以采用Jerry之前的文章 基于SAP Kyma的订单编排增强介绍 介绍的方法,基于SAP Hybris Commerce的订单创建事件实现一个Lambda Function. 创建订单时,我们把Jane的微信open ID存储到订单某个字段里。等订单生成完毕时,在Lambda Function内将该open ID取出,再调用Customer Coupon的分配API,将优惠券分配给微信open ID对应的Jane的Hybris用户。

这也就是SAP推荐的使用SAP Cloud Platform Extension Factory对SAP Commerce进行增强的方式。

因为这个场景里,Jane的行为方式依次是Like, Promote, Get reward, 所以我们把这个原型项目取名叫Promolike.

这就是我们SAP成都研究院数字创新空间Promolike原型今年在SAP上海2020 DKOM上的展台:

我们希望通过这个原型,向SAP生态圈传递这样一个信息:SAP产品本身具备了足够的灵活性和扩展性,即使对于社交电商这种国内玩得很火的新业务模式,稍加扩展之后也仍然可以实现和运行。感谢阅读。

更多阅读

要获取更多Jerry的原创文章,请关注公众号"汪子熙":

0
0
分享到:
评论

相关推荐

    SAP hybris电商实施和开发

    此外,SAP hybris基于Spring框架进行开发,Spring框架是一个广泛使用的开源框架,它为企业应用提供了全面的编程和配置模型。这种组合不仅加强了hybris在电子商务领域的竞争力,还允许开发者利用Spring丰富的生态系统...

    SAP Hybris 框架介绍

    SAP Hybris是一个高度可扩展的电子商务框架,主要用于构建复杂的多渠道商务解决方案。它由SAP公司开发,旨在帮助企业实现线上和线下的无缝融合,提供个性化的购物体验,并且能够处理大量的交易数据。Hybris框架的...

    SAP hybris 6.4 B2C平台搭建文档

    通过以上步骤,我们可以成功搭建起一个基于SAP Hybris 6.4的B2C平台。在整个过程中,需要注意环境的配置、配置文件的正确性以及项目的正确构建方式。对于初学者而言,理解每一个步骤背后的原理对于后续的开发和维护...

    hybris commerce developer traning 1

    hybris(现为SAP Commerce Cloud)是一个多渠道电子商务软件解决方案,它为商业机构提供了一个灵活的平台,以开展多渠道电子商务和增强型客户服务。根据所提供的文件内容,我们可以从中提取出以下几个知识点: 1. ...

    海通安恒SAP社交电商方案.pdf

    本方案基于Hybris平台,提供了最全面的电子商务解决方案,包括WCMS、M-Commerce、PCM等模块化和服务导向架构。 全渠道发展的定义是指企业通过多种渠道与顾客互动,包括网站、实体店、服务终端、直邮销售目录、呼叫...

    藏经阁-SAP Hybris零售行业解决方案 SAP Retail Industry Solution with Hybris

    SAP Hybris作为客户参与和商务的基础,与SAP ERP Retail、SCM、CRM等模块紧密集成,形成一个强大的全渠道生态系统,包括云销售、营销数据管理、物联网(IoT)工具、社交媒体互动等,为零售商和品牌商提供全方位的...

    SAP hybris电子商务全渠道解决方案介绍

    SAP hybris电子商务全渠道解决方案介绍 加QQ2823792750 获取

    掌握Java-SAP Hybris组件:专业级培训与实践

    例如,可以基于`CMSParagraphComponent`创建一个新的组件,其中包含额外的媒体属性。示例代码如下所示: ```xml <itemtype code="CMSMediaParagraphComponent" generate="true" jaloclass="de.hybris.platform....

    hybrisCommerceDeveloperTraining1.01Overview共26页.pdf.zip

    【标题】"hybris Commerce Developer Training 1.01 Overview 共26页" 是一个关于SAP hybris Commerce平台的开发者培训课程的概述。这个压缩包包含了26页的培训材料,旨在帮助IT专业人士深入理解hybris Commerce的...

    hybris的搭建、使用、集成eclipse(中文版)

    5. **启动与调试**: 在Eclipse的“Run Configurations”中,新建一个SAP Hybris Server配置,选择已创建的服务器实例,设置断点,即可进行调试。 **注意事项** - 翻译可能存在不准确之处,建议参考官方英文文档以...

    Java-SAP Hybris Template Builder:高效构建电子商务模板的终极工具

    本文旨在详细介绍 Java-SAP Hybris Template Builder 的核心功能、应用场景以及如何利用这一工具来提升开发效率和项目可维护性。 #### 二、Java-SAP Hybris Template Builder 概述 Java-SAP Hybris Template ...

    hybris-base-image:使用 ubuntu 的 Hybris Commerce Suite 基本映像

    由于对当前版本和文档的访问仅限于为 SAP Hybris parterns 工作的人员,因此我无法使该项目保持最新状态。 因此,如果您想维护这个项目,请随时与我联系。hybris-base-image Hybris Commerce Suite 的基本映像,...

    hybris电商开发实施路线和流程

    hybris电商开发实施路线和流程hybris电商开发实施路线和流程

    hybris电商开发实施路线和流程.pptx

    本文将详细介绍SAP hybris作为一个强大的电子商务解决方案的开发实施路线、流程和核心技术。SAP hybris是一款专为B2C和B2B电子商务设计的全面解决方案,以其模块化和服务导向的架构著称,强调对电子商务的专注和强大...

    hybrisCommerceDeveloperTraini

    【标题】"hybris Commerce Developer Training" 是一个针对 hybris 平台的电商开发者培训课程。这个课程旨在帮助开发者深入理解 hybris Commerce 的核心概念、架构以及开发流程,以提升他们在电商领域的专业技能。 ...

    hybris帮助文档

    总之,Hybris是一个强大且灵活的电子商务平台,其全面的功能和强大的技术特性使其成为企业构建全渠道商务策略的理想选择。通过深入学习和理解Hybris,无论是开发者还是电商运营人员,都能从中受益,提升业务效率和...

    用于客户Gmail插件的SAP Hybris Cloud「SAP Hybris Cloud for Customer Gmail Add-in」-crx插件

    该扩展将Gmail与SAP Hybris Cloud for Customer解决方案连接起来,在向潜在客户和客户发送电子邮件时提供所有销售信息的快速浏览,并允许您链接电子邮件对话,搜索重复联系人,创建新的潜在客户,任务和访问,全部...

Global site tag (gtag.js) - Google Analytics